Hanbao Steel posts record output at continuous annealing line in March

Tuesday, 17 April 2012 17:39:05 (GMT+3)   |  
       

Chinese steelmaker Hebei Iron and Steel Co. has announced that its subsidiary Hanbao Iron and Steel Co. (Hanbao Steel) achieved an output of 66,100 mt at the continuous annealing line at its cold rolling plant in March this year. This volume constitutes an all-time record monthly output for the continuous annealing line. 99.32 percent of products were found to be in line with the required standards.
